Abstract

The invention discloses a kind of Intelligent desk lamp controllers, including controller, photodiode, infrared sensor module, timing module and ultrasound measurement module, photodiode, infrared sensor module, timing module and ultrasound measurement module are electrically connected with the controller, photodiode is for detecting luminous intensity, infrared sensor module is for detecting whether that someone is close, timing module is for being arranged timing and display time, ultrasound measurement module is for detecting human body destage lamp distance, controller is also connected with buzzer, and buzzer is reminded for timed reminding and spacing.The present invention increases photodiode, infrared sensor module and ultrasound measurement module, brightness regulation can be carried out according to intensity variation using photodiode, realize that energy conservation and intelligent eyeshield can be realized " people Lai Dengliang, turning off the light when you leave " using infrared sensor module, automatically control lamp source opening and closing, using ultrasound measurement module, people alarms once the too close buzzer of destage lamp, and people is reminded to adjust the sitting posture of oneself, otherwise it is be easy to cause bow-backed and cervical spondylosis, considerably increases the functionality of desk lamp.

Advantages of the present invention is as follows:
(1) intelligent eyeshield: present desk lamp cannot be with an automatic light meter according to environment, so both not energy-efficient also hurt eyes, using photosensitive two Pole pipe is photosensitive, and desk lamp is allowed to automatically adjust lamplight brightness, not only energy conservation also eyeshield;
(2) intelligent switch: " people Lai Dengliang, turning off the light when you leave " is realized with infrared sensor module;
(3) timing learns: one timer of installation, people can see the time, and timing also can be set, and timing one arrives, buzzing Device is had a rest with regard to warning reminding people, is paid attention to using eye, also be improved learning efficiency;
(4) it adjusts sitting posture: being mentioned as soon as installing a ultrasound measurement module on desk lamp once the too close buzzer of people's destage lamp is alarmed Awake people adjusts the sitting posture of oneself, otherwise be easy to cause bow-backed and cervical spondylosis;
(5) long-range control: there are one communication modules, and when desk lamp automatic distinguishing function breaks down, the desk lamp of light yellow can be given Owner sends short messages, and allows owner's answer short message, and desk lamp automatically powers off immediately, thus energy saving.
